Do Spring Bars Need Be Removed While Turning in Reverse with Fastway e2 Weight Distribution System
Question:
I have a Fastway E2 WE hitch. Do I need to remove the round bars before making a sharp turn as I back my trailer into my driveway?

Expert Reply:
Yes, you will need to disengage the spring bars on your Fastway e2 Weight Distribution System like part # FA94-00-1000 if you will be making any tight turns while in reverse. This will ensure you do not put too much tension on the bars which could cause them to break. You can disengage them by simply removing the L-pins that hold the spring bars to the frame brackets.
